VPN Connection PNG and SVG Icon
A VPN Connection in AWS provides encrypted connectivity between your data center or device and your AWS VPC.

Key Features
- Establishes secure, encrypted links between AWS and other networks.
- Supports both Site-to-Site and Client VPNs.
- Uses resilient connections for high availability.
- Enables hybrid cloud architectures.
Common Use Cases
- Enable secure encrypted access for remote branch offices to AWS
- Set up a backup link to AWS in case of Direct Connect failure
- Provide developers with secure private access to AWS environments
